The Business of Celebranding

In the United States, spending money has become a favorite pastime and watching celebrities is our cultural obsession. A recent Gallop Poll shows that people in the United States spend an average of $65 per day. Shopping has become a method of lifting the spirits on a bad day or celebrating an accomplishment. Retail therapy is the excuse many people use to justify their unnecessary spending. And what is one of the best ways to feel like a million bucks? Purchasing products that are designed or endorsed by your favorite celebrity, of course.
